RoboGifter.com

Created RoboGifter (www.robogifter.com), a full-stack AI recommendation engine using Next.js 15 (App Router) and Node.js, leveraging Google Gemini and OpenAI to generate personalized gift ideas from multidimensional user inputs.
  • Engineered prompt templates and a robust response-parsing layer to transform unstructured LLM outputs into type-safe JSON, ensuring seamless integration with the Amazon Affiliate API.
  • Optimized application latency and costs by implementing a Multi-layered Redis Caching Strategy, reducing external API calls by 80%.
  • Designed a sophisticated CI/CD pipeline in GitHub Actions for automated deployments to Google Cloud Run, utilizing a containerized architecture and Google Secret Manager for secure credential handling.
  • Developed a high-performance frontend with React 19 and TypeScript, implementing Streaming/Suspense for faster page loads and a stateful URL system for shareable results.
  • Managed full-cycle product growth, from engineering to marketing, by executing Meta Ads campaigns to drive user acquisition and engagement for the platform.

Technology Stack

Frontend: Next.js 15 (App Router): React 19,TypeScript,Tailwind CSS, React Context API
Backend & AI: Node.js / Express, Google Gemini & OpenAI LLMs. Amazon Affiliate API
Infrastructure & Performance: Redis, Google Cloud Run, Docker, Google Custom Search API
DevOps & Security: GitHub Actions, Google Cloud Secret Manager, Helmet.js, Google Tag Manager